Abstract

In this study, four different levels of oxygen enriched burning experiments in a hazardous waste incinerator were performed. The effect of the oxygen enriched burning on the throughput of the incinerator and on the formation and emission of polychlorinated dibenzo-p-dioxins (PCDD) and dibenzofurans (PCDF), polychlorinated biphenyls (PCB), chlorinated benzenes, chlorinated phenols, and nitrogen oxides (NOx) were evaluated.
